What fun car would you guys recommend for a 10 day Euro Road trip.

Ideally I want something with;
A fair bit of power for all the mountain roads,
Convertible,
Seats 2,
As cheap as possible (max probably £3-4k)
Something that won't be impossible to sell on after the trip.
Preferably with aircon too!

My mate and I can't decide on what to use, we are building a kit car but it won't be ready in time for the planned trip so we were going to buy something to use just for the trip and then re-sell once we get back.

So far suggestions are;

MX5 - not enough power
old jag/bmw - not convertible and a bit on the heavy side
xk8 convertible - too expensive
